std::match_results<BidirIt,Alloc>::length

difference_type length( size_type n = 0 ) const;
|
(since C++11) | |
Returns the length of the specified sub-match.
If n == 0, the length of the entire matched expression is returned.
If n > 0 && n < size() , the length of n th
if n >= size(), a length of the unmatched match is returned.
The call is equivalent to ( *this) [n].length ( )
ready()
must be true. Otherwise, the behavior is undefined.
Parameters
n | - | integral number specifying which match to examine |
Return value
The length of the specified match or sub-match.
